A restaurant charges $11 for a buffet plus $2 for each drink. Another restaurant charges $14 for a buffet plus $1 for each drink. The system of equations is graphed below. Part 1: What is the solution? Part 2: Show your work to verify the solution for both equations

11 + 2d = 14 + 1d 2d-1d=14-11 d=3 If two drinks are ordered, at both restaurants, the total will come to $17. 11 + 2(3) = 14 + 1(3) 11 + 6 = 14 + 3 17 = 17
